Make it illegal for Nurseries to charge on Bank Holidays or when closed.

What the petition asks
I am a full time working parent, I have been since my daughter was 9 months old. I have paid in the region of £1300-950 a month for my child to attend full time nursery. Nurseries still have the right to charge full fees when closed or Bank holidays. Which means double fees or unpaid/annual leave.
I understand it is so difficult for mums to take that leap back to work when childcare costs so much money!!! Unless you're unemployed or less hours you don't seem to be entitled to anything. Nurseries then have the right to charge for days the nursery is closed. Including Bank Holidays, training days & other. Some of us working parents that don't have family then have to pay out double fees or have to take annual or unpaid leave for this facility. It's another penalty that should not be allowed.
